- A basketball team's owner learns his star player once threw a game. The player's shady brother-in-law (ironically, a used car salesman) has committed to a dangerous gangster that he has the player "in his pocket" and threatens to contact the commissioner if the owner does not go along with his scheme. In a physical confrontation, the much larger owner accidentally kills the other man, and the owner hides the body while directing his mentally challenged aide to dispose of the dead man's car after making up an excuse. Barnaby is hired by the now deceased man's wife -- who is the sister of the player who threw the game -- to try to locate her husband.
